Chapter 104: The Haotian Stars and the Coming Storm
Most of the other Elders in the Clear Sky Main Hall were also like this, their sallow old faces revealing expressions of doting.
Only the Seventh Elder frowned, glancing at the young girl with open displeasure.
The young girl in white was none other than Tang Yuehua, the daughter of the Clear Sky Sect's current Sect Master, Tang Tian, and the younger sister of Tang Hao and Tang Xiao.
The reason the Seventh Elder disliked the young girl was entirely because her Spirit had undergone a mutation. Her Spirit Power was permanently stuck at Level 9, preventing her from inheriting the pure Clear Sky Hammer Spirit.
If not for her being the Sect Master's daughter, he would have long since sent Tang Yuehua to the outer Sect. How could she then be qualified to step into this 'sacred and solemn' Clear Sky Main Hall?
Upon hearing the talk of the Sect Competition, Tang Yuehua's beautiful eyes, as deep as stars and bright as the moon, instantly lit up.
"Will Brother Xiao and Brother Hao also go then?"
"Mm," Tang Tian nodded, a rare, soft smile touching his stern face.
"Hehe, then I want to go too!" Tang Yuehua's beautiful eyes curved into two shallow crescent moons.
"The Sect Competition is no small matter," the Seventh Elder reprimanded, his voice sharp. "Any Spirit Master who accompanies the Sect Master represents the face of our Clear Sky Sect."
"It's fine that your Elder brothers are exceptionally talented, but what are you, a young girl with no combat power, going there for?"
His words were extremely harsh, almost implying that Tang Yuehua was useless.
This caused Tang Tian, and even the other six Elders, to frown. The atmosphere in the hall grew tense.
A flicker of disappointment crossed Tang Yuehua's eyes, but she was incredibly smart.
To avoid putting her father in a difficult position, before the awkward atmosphere could settle, she made a playful face at the Seventh Elder.
She quickly ran to Tang Tian's side and linked her arm through his, acting pitiful, all while not forgetting to playfully blink her bright, big eyes.
"Father, please take me, okay? I haven't seen Brother Xiao and Brother Hao in so long. I've almost forgotten what they look like!"
"Yuehua, I'm afraid it's more likely they've forgotten what you look like," Tang Tian laughed heartily, the tension broken.
When Tang Hao and Tang Xiao went out for training, she was still an 11 or 12-year-old girl. Now, 4 years later, she had grown into a vibrant, beautiful young woman.
"Sect Master, I think you should take Yuehua along. It would be good for the three siblings to reunite," one of the other Elders chimed in, amused by Tang Yuehua's mischievous demeanor. The rest murmured their agreement, unable to stop smiling.
This was also why, even though Tang Yuehua had no cultivation talent, the Elders still liked her so much.
She was not only sensible but also had a high emotional intelligence, and her presence brightened the otherwise stern hall.
The Seventh Elder also knew he had spoken incorrectly just now, so he snorted lightly and no longer objected.
Ultimately, Tang Yuehua got her wish.
In a certain Soul Beast Forest, far from the peaks of the Clear Sky Sect, a bonfire burned by a riverside.
Two men were roasting fish. Several consecutive days of fighting high-level Spirit Beasts had taken a toll on their physical strength. Before reaching the point of transcending the mortal coil, eating was always necessary.
The rich, savory aroma of the roasted fish wafted everywhere, attracting many low-level Spirit Beasts, their eyes gleaming in the twilight.
But these low-level Spirit Beasts only watched from a safe distance, not daring to approach.
The two men appeared ordinary, but their strength was exceptionally formidable.
The gruesome deaths of those 10,000-year Spirit Beasts a few days prior were still vivid in their minds, and they dared not attempt to snatch the food.
"How is it, Big Brother? What did Father's letter say?" One of the men, who looked younger and had a more rebellious aura, took a big gulp from a wine jar and then asked.
As he spoke, a hint of blood-red light flashed in his eyes, and a palpable white light—his Domain—emanated from his body, before turning colorless.
The surrounding air instantly became cold, and the low-level Spirit Beasts, sensing the terrifying killing intent, scattered like birds and beasts.
"Father wants us both to go to Spirit City and meet up with him." The other man looked a bit older than the first, his personality more composed.
If the former was impetuous in his youth, then the latter was as steady as a mountain, giving off a mature, reliable feeling.
Of course, even if he wasn't mature, it wouldn't do; he was almost 50 years old.
The former was also not young, in his 30s.
Their faces were extremely similar. It was not hard to see that they were blood brothers.
And they were none other than Tang Hao and Tang Xiao, the two brothers who had gone out to train.
In the Spirit Master's world, they were the Haotian Twin Stars, whose names had become famous in recent years.
"Why go to Spirit City?" Tang Hao frowned, his voice laced with disdain.
Ever since High Priest Qian Daoliu lost to their grandfather, Tang Chen, the Clear Sky Sect disciples had become arrogant.
They felt that Spirit Hall, despite losing to the Clear Sky Sect, was relying on its numerical superiority to constantly suppress the Clear Sky Sect in the Spirit Master's world.
This also led to most Clear Sky Sect disciples having no good feelings towards Spirit Hall.
They even looked down on Spirit Hall Spirit Masters, just as Tang Chen had looked down on Qian Daoliu.
Tang Hao, with his proud and rebellious nature, was naturally no exception.
"The new Sect Competition is about to begin, and the venue is Spirit City."
"As one of the Upper Three Sects, the Clear Sky Sect is naturally invited."
"Father wants us both to go and broaden our horizons."
Tang Xiao picked up the wine jar and took a big gulp, his mood becoming much heavier.
He was considerably older than Tang Hao, by a full 15 years.
In his youth, he had been fortunate enough to accompany his grandfather, Tang Chen, to Spirit City to watch the previous Sect Competition.
Although Tang Chen had rampaged and brought supreme glory to the Clear Sky Sect, similarly, the tragic state of the participating Sects was also vivid in his mind.
Each one fought desperately for rankings, battling to the point of bloodshed.
Now that Tang Chen was not present, although the Clear Sky Sect was still powerful, it no longer possessed the absolute crushing strength it had last time.
Facing the Blue Lightning Tyrant Dragon Clan and the Seven Treasure Glazed Tile School, which now had two Titled Douluo, this would be no small challenge for his father.
Upon hearing this, Tang Hao became even more displeased with Spirit Hall, and he snorted coldly, "Since when did the status of our Clear Sky Sect as the World's Number One Sect depend on Spirit Hall's decision?"
"This is a rule from ancient times, which has been in effect for over a hundred years," Tang Xiao said with some helplessness.
"Hmph, it's nothing more than Spirit Hall's means to weaken the various Sects. Sooner or later, I will break this rule!" Tang Hao took a fierce swig of wine, angrily smashed the wine jar, and declared his ambition with soaring spirit.
"How can it be that easy?" Tang Xiao smiled bitterly and shook his head, not saying anything to dampen his brother's spirits.
Then, as if he remembered something, he added gently, "Oh, right, when the time comes, that girl Yuehua will also go, so the three of us siblings can have a good reunion."
Upon hearing this, Tang Hao's mind conjured an image of his sister's cute smiling face when he left home, and a gentle smile also appeared on his face.
"Then I'm really looking forward to it. Speaking of which, that girl must have grown up by now."
As the two spoke, two figures, one black and one white, floated out from the opposite hillside, their movements silent as ghosts.
"One Spirit Saint, one Spirit Douluo. Are these the Haotian Twin Stars that our Lord wanted us to secretly monitor?"
"Their strength is indeed formidable, but they lack vigilance too much," Mo Ya said, his voice low as he gazed at the bonfire below.
Bai Feng stood beside him with his arms crossed. "It's not a lack; it's simply unnecessary."
"In this Soul Beast Forest, the strongest Spirit Beast will not exceed 50,000 years. For them, with their Spirit Saint and Spirit Douluo cultivation, it poses no threat whatsoever."
"You, you really are as merciless as ever when you speak," Mo Ya pouted. "Speaking of which, our Lord clearly gave us half a year to learn the knowledge and language of this new World and acquire spirit rings."
"Why, in less than two months, did you impatiently seek out the Haotian Twin Stars?"
"The language of this World has been mostly mastered, knowledge can be accumulated slowly, and spirit rings only need to be selected appropriately based on our Lord's theory," Bai Feng found a whole host of reasons for himself.
In reality, he was uneasy about Qin Xuan.
He wanted to complete the task Qin Xuan assigned as quickly as possible to prove his and Mo Ya's value.
Only tools that prove their value will not be discarded, and only then can his and Mo Ya's lives be preserved to the greatest extent in this strange, new world.
